Skip to content

Conversation

willkroboth
Copy link
Contributor

Modifies documentation for CommandAPI/CommandAPI#667, which splits commandapi-bukkit-test-toolkit into commandapi-spigot-test-toolkit and commandapi-paper-test-toolkit.

I added a preference toggle for Paper/Spigot:

image image

Still todo is the https://docs.commandapi.dev/test/load-mock-commandapi page. That page features code examples which are slightly different on Paper vs Spigot. This may require multiple modules in the reference-code Gradle project, allowing some files to be built based off the commandapi-paper-test-toolkit dependency vs the commandapi-spigot-test-toolkit dependency.

@willkroboth willkroboth force-pushed the dev/spigot-paper-test-toolkit branch from 8058037 to ed3ca55 Compare September 7, 2025 15:04
@willkroboth willkroboth changed the base branch from ver/11.0.0-SNAPSHOT to dev/commandapi-paper September 7, 2025 15:04
@willkroboth willkroboth force-pushed the dev/spigot-paper-test-toolkit branch from ed3ca55 to 0d7a155 Compare September 7, 2025 15:10
@willkroboth
Copy link
Contributor Author

I think I'm going to wait for #4 to do the main Spigot/Paper split before finishing up this PR. I need separate modules in the reference-code project to properly implement the examples on the load-mock-commandapi page.

@willkroboth willkroboth force-pushed the dev/spigot-paper-test-toolkit branch from 06ed85d to 85f9122 Compare October 1, 2025 13:44
@willkroboth willkroboth marked this pull request as ready for review October 1, 2025 14:10
@DerEchtePilz DerEchtePilz merged commit 08f1fe1 into dev/commandapi-paper Oct 4,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ants